What Does a Research Associate Do?

As a research associate, you conduct research and analysis as directed by a senior researcher or project manager. Researchers work in a number of fields, including medical science, the social sciences, natural sciences, finance, management, and academia. Your specific duties and responsibilities differ depending on the field in which you work, but some features of your work are similar across industries. You typically do primary and secondary source research, organize and process data, analyze said data, and report on your findings to lead researchers or clinicians.

What are Research Associates?

Research Associates are professionals who support research projects in academic, scientific, or business settings. They assist with designing studies, collecting and analyzing data, and preparing reports or publications. Research Associates often work under the supervision of principal investigators or senior researchers, contributing their expertise to advance the goals of the project. Their responsibilities can vary depending on the field, but typically involve both administrative and hands-on research tasks.

What is the difference between Research Associate vs Research Scientist?

AspectResearch AssociateResearch Scientist
Required CredentialsBachelor's or Master's degree in relevant fieldMaster's or PhD in relevant field
Work EnvironmentLaboratories, research institutions, universitiesLaboratories, research institutions, industry settings
Employer & Industry UsageAcademic, government, non-profitAcademic, industry, biotech, pharma
Common Search & ComparisonYesYes

The main difference between a Research Associate and a Research Scientist lies in their educational requirements and level of experience. Research Associates typically hold a bachelor's or master's degree and assist in research projects, while Research Scientists usually have a PhD and lead research efforts. Both roles work in similar environments like labs and research institutions, but Research Scientists often have more independence and responsibility.

Position Summary:
The UCANR Fire Network is a statewide team with expertise across a wide range of disciplines, including fire science and ecology, prescribed fire, home hardening and defensible space, community and regional planning, grazing and fire interactions, and much more. The Network includes specialists on UC campuses, advisors and staff in local communities, and broad networks of partners and volunteers. The goal of the Fire Network is to inspire and empower Californians, through research, education and outreach, policy, and training.
Department Summary:
The Staff Research Associate III (SRA III) will assist Fire Advisors in the full range of program implementation duties on methods to reduce wildfire risk, especially through prescribed fire, in Mariposa and Madera Counties. The incumbent will lead a program, overseeing employees with support from a Fire Advisor as needed, focused on helping to conduct, manage and evaluate an educational program and facilitate collaborative partnerships to increase the use of prescribed fire throughout the service areas. Field work includes assisting with field experiments, data collection of long-term monitoring plots, prescribed fire implementation, and working with landowners and research partners to coordinate research opportunities throughout the region. Office tasks include research data management, data summarization, development of social media content and formation of educational material for workshops and trainings on topics including but not limited to community wildfire preparedness, vegetation management, land stewardship, and prescribed fire.
This position is a career appointment that is 100% fixed.
The home department is the ANR Fire Network. While this position normally is based in Mariposa, CA, this position is eligible for hybrid flexible work arrangements for applicants living in the State of California at this time.
